A prominent hotel brand in Manchester is seeking a passionate Receptionist for £12.50ph, 30 hours per week. You will be the face of the hotel, setting the tone for guest experiences and handling queries. The role offers excellent perks and the chance for career progression through apprenticeship programs. If you possess natural hospitality charm and a commitment to high standards in service, this may be your next step.

How to prepare for a job interview at Malmaison
✨Show Your Hospitality Charm
As a Guest Experience Host, your natural charm is key. During the interview, let your personality shine through. Share anecdotes that highlight your passion for hospitality and how you've gone above and beyond for guests in the past.
✨Know the Hotel Inside Out
Research the hotel brand thoroughly. Understand their values, services, and what sets them apart in the luxury market. This knowledge will not only impress the interviewers but also help you tailor your responses to align with their expectations.
✨Prepare for Common Scenarios
Think about common guest queries or complaints you might encounter at the front desk. Prepare thoughtful responses or solutions to these scenarios. This shows that you’re proactive and ready to handle challenges with ease.
✨Dress the Part
First impressions matter, especially in a luxury setting. Dress smartly and professionally for your interview. This demonstrates your understanding of the hotel's standards and your commitment to representing them well.
